Transaction 7e05fa0334e2a59753ecab768c48a670c52c603c0ff54b20a241036eda286975
1 Input
2 Outputs
- 7e05fa0334e2a59753ecab768c48a670c52c603c0ff54b20a241036eda286975:0
- 7e05fa0334e2a59753ecab768c48a670c52c603c0ff54b20a241036eda286975:1
value 59955191
address 1KFP9EWiKWWDk1ThA9iwEkp1kCDS96pqMm
value 2319660
address 1HjziRxDeufeWYY7pgVbFEd8eK4EH2vpcU